Kitchen Makeover

This kitchen renovation was a long, drawn-out DIY project.  In fact, it’s the first real project Chelsea took on in her own home.  The cabinets were originally the same cherry-stain color as the floor.  This made it really dark and dreary in there.  When we moved in, the counter tops were an outdated white laminate, and the appliances were old and dingy.  What’s more, the walls were covered in wallpaper that was simply not our style.

Our solution?  Paint the cabinets (Sherwin Williams Alabaster), remove wallpaper and paint the walls (Sherwin Williams Hearts of Palm), order new counter tops (Corian from Lowes), and add a classy subway tile backsplash with contrasting grout.  After replacing the light fixtures and DIY-ing a roman shade, the kitchen is one of my favorite places in the house…which is a good thing, since I’m in there all. the. time.  🙂
